The Palmelle read

Mixed. Mentor Hills Post Acute carries a Palmelle Clarity Score of 68 out of 100, derived from federal CMS Care Compare data plus Ohio state records. Health inspection rating sits at 3-star, staffing at 1-star, quality measures at 4-star. Long-stay antipsychotic prescribing is at 14.6 percent, above the 14 percent national median. Long-stay sedative prescribing is at 31.2 percent, above the 15 percent national median. RN coverage is 0.48 hours per resident per day. Nurse turnover 63 percent.

What is the CMS rating for Mentor Hills Post Acute?

Mentor Hills Post Acute has an overall CMS Care Compare rating of 2 out of 5 stars. It scores 3 of 5 on health inspection, 1 of 5 on staffing, and 4 of 5 on quality measures. The overall rating averages these subscores with health inspection weighted more heavily.

Does Mentor Hills Post Acute use antipsychotic medications?

14.6 percent of long-stay residents at Mentor Hills Post Acute are on antipsychotic medications, above the 14 percent national median (CMS measure 481). Sedative and sleep-medication use is elevated at 31.2 percent. Medications can be appropriate, but they are also commonly used to manage dementia-related behaviors instead of staffing or non-medication approaches. Worth asking on a tour: what behaviors the medication targets and what non-medication options were tried first.

What does F-689 mean on Mentor Hills Post Acute's record?

F-689 is a federal CMS deficiency code for inadequate supervision resulting in actual resident harm. If Mentor Hills Post Acute has any active citations or CMS conflict flags, they appear with their details in the record section above, along with any operator response.
